Regular expression validation is working clientside but not serverside

I have an Userid with the following syntax: It starts with the uppercase letters SSF followed by \ and a lowercase letter c. Then it's 3 numbers and 3 letters. (Example: SSF\c890rbr). I believe the regular expression for this should be /^SSF\\c\d{3}[a-zA-Z]{3}$/

The validation is working clientside but not serverside. The problem with the serverside validation is that a valid userid does not pass through.
